(图片来源网络,侵删)
鸿蒙系统实战短视频App 从0到1掌握HarmonyOS(完结)来百度APP畅享高清图片//下栽のke:http://quangneng.com/3706/如何在鸿蒙OS上开发短视频App1. 了解HarmonyOS首先,了解HarmonyOS的基本概念和架构HarmonyOS是一个面向多设备的分布式操作系统,具有高度灵活性和适配性,可应用于智能手机、智能穿戴、智能家居等多种设备上2. 准备开发环境下载HarmonyOS Studio: 这是HarmonyOS官方提供的IDE,支持开发HarmonyOS应用配置开发环境: 确保你的系统满足HarmonyOS Studio的最低要求,并安装所需的SDK和工具3. 学习基础知识掌握Java语言: HarmonyOS主要使用Java语言进行开发,因此你需要熟悉Java编程语言的基础知识了解HarmonyOS组件: 学习HarmonyOS提供的UI组件、布局、事件处理等基本组件和框架4. 设计短视频App功能确定功能需求: 确定你的短视频App需要的功能,比如用户登录、视频浏览、上传、评论等界面设计: 使用HarmonyOS Studio设计App的界面,选择合适的UI组件,创建吸引人的用户界面5. 实现功能开发视频浏览功能: 使用HarmonyOS提供的组件和网络请求功能,从服务器获取视频列表,并展示在App界面上用户交互和上传功能: 实现用户上传视频的功能,包括录制视频、编辑、上传等评论和互动功能: 开发用户评论和互动功能,如点赞、分享、评论等6. 测试与调试单元测试: 编写和运行单元测试,确保App的各个功能模块都能正常工作调试和优化: 使用HarmonyOS Studio的调试工具解决可能出现的问题,并优化App的性能和用户体验7. 发布与推广应用签名和打包: 为你的App进行签名和打包准备发布所需的文件应用商店发布: 将你的App提交到HarmonyOS应用商店或其他应用平台,让更多用户下载和使用8. 持续优化与更新用户反馈: 收集用户反馈,不断改进和优化App的功能和体验更新迭代: 定期发布更新版本,修复bug并增加新的功能,保持App的竞争力和吸引力这个过程只是一个概述,实际开发涉及更多具体细节和技术挑战随着对HarmonyOS开发的更深入了解和实践,你将能够更好地掌握开发短视频App所需的技能记得随时查阅官方文档、参与开发者社区以及不断练习实践,这些都能帮助你更快地掌握HarmonyOS开发技巧鸿蒙系统实战短视频App 的市场需求平台适应性: 确保你的短视频App能够充分利用鸿蒙OS的特性,提供流畅的用户体验考虑到不同设备的屏幕大小和分辨率,以及设备性能的差异创新功能: 引入一些独特的、吸引人的功能,以区别于其他短视频App这可以包括利用鸿蒙OS的分布式技术,例如多设备协同工作用户界面设计: 鸿蒙OS有一套独特的设计准则,包括分布式界面、全场景设计等确保你的App遵循这些准则,以提供一致的用户体验安全性和隐私: 用户对于个人信息的保护和应用的安全性越来越关注在设计App时,确保符合鸿蒙OS和行业的隐私和安全标准社交互动: 短视频App通常具有社交互动的元素,例如评论、点赞、分享等确保你的App提供了强大的社交功能,与用户之间建立紧密的联系多媒体处理: 由于短视频App的核心是视频内容,因此在鸿蒙系统上有效地处理多媒体是至关重要的确保你的App能够高效地录制、编辑和播放视频本地化需求: 考虑到不同地区和文化的差异,提供本地化的内容和功能,以吸引更广泛的用户群市场推广: 制定一个有效的市场推广策略,以确保你的App能够被广泛认知和接受考虑与鸿蒙OS的生态系统集成,以提高曝光度用户反馈机制: 提供用户反馈的途径,收集用户意见和建议,并及时做出调整和改进可以提供一些通用的概念和特性,以帮助你构想一个在鸿蒙系统上实战的短视频App全场景体验: 利用鸿蒙OS的全场景能力,使你的短视频App在不同设备上提供一致而灵活的体验用户可以在手机、平板和电视等多种设备上轻松观看和分享短视频分布式技术: 使用鸿蒙OS的分布式技术,让用户在不同设备上共享短视频内容例如,用户在手机上录制的视频可以直接在鸿蒙OS支持的其他设备上进行编辑或播放多设备协同: 考虑设计一些创新功能,使得用户可以同时在多个鸿蒙OS设备上协同工作例如,用户可以在手机上编辑视频,同时在平板上查看实时预览鸿蒙生态整合: 利用鸿蒙OS的开放生态系统,与其他鸿蒙OS应用和服务集成这可以包括与社交媒体平台的集成,方便用户分享短视频内容分布式数据存储: 利用鸿蒙OS的分布式数据存储,确保用户的短视频在不同设备上同步这样,用户可以在任何设备上继续观看或编辑他们的短视频语音交互: 考虑添加语音交互功能,使用户可以通过语音命令快速浏览、搜索和分享短视频内容本地化体验: 根据用户所在地区的文化和语言差异,提供本地化的内容和界面,以增加用户的亲和感请注意,这些只是一些建议和想法,实际的应用可能需要更具体的业务需求和市场研究在设计和开发过程中,确保充分了解鸿蒙OS的特性和用户需求,以提供一个创新、实用且适应全场景的短视频App
0 评论